Key Features to Consider

So what makes a great desk even when you're sticking to a "desk under $50" budget? First, think about size. What space do you actually need? Next, think about the material. Durability is key. A metal frame with a simple wood or composite top is generally going to hold up better over time, although plastic options can be very durable and easy to clean. Finally, check that the legs are stable, since a wobbly work surface is far from ideal.

Wall-Mounted Solutions

Wall-mounted desks are another clever solution for maximizing space. These units do not take up floor space, making them ideal for small apartments and rooms where space is extremely limited. They can provide a compact work surface and can sometimes fold flat against the wall when not in use.

Q: What materials are commonly used for a "desk under $50," and how durable are they? A: Common materials for budget desks include particleboard, laminate, plastic, and metal frames. Durability varies, but a metal frame with a composite or laminate top is generally a good option. Plastic can also be quite durable and very easy to clean. Always check reviews for specific models of a "desk under $50" to get insights into their robustness.

Q: What size desk can I expect to find when looking for a "desk under $50"? A: You likely won't find very large desks at this price point. Most desks under $50 will be compact, designed to fit in smaller spaces, and will generally be suitable for a laptop and some papers. Be sure to check dimensions of a "desk under $50" before purchasing, if possible, to ensure it suits your space and requirements.
